Portsmouth Square

Portsmouth Square (traditional Chinese: 花園角; simplified Chinese: 花园角; pinyin: Huāyuán jiǎo; Jyutping: Faa1jyun4 Gok3), formerly known as Portsmouth Plaza, and originally known as Plaza de Yerba Buena, or simply La Plaza, is a one-block plaza (1.5-acre (0.61 ha)) in Chinatown, San Francisco, California, United States. Portsmouth Square is the first park in San Francisco, predating both Washington Square (1847) and Union Square (1850).
